Transaction d51a63f22ed08a7e106c2be107b019863598e5fd82ef4114e55883de3814d2e5

1 Input
2 Outputs
  • d51a63f22ed08a7e106c2be107b019863598e5fd82ef4114e55883de3814d2e5:0
  • value  180000
    address  36sKnYbqmnyMrMhcT6keg2ah7ddZqDjJX6
  • d51a63f22ed08a7e106c2be107b019863598e5fd82ef4114e55883de3814d2e5:1
  • value  4244392
    address  1B7mho3AgQLDCkjDFueEoXikA6AStq9qdL